My absolute favorite of the challenge! In fact, I'm adding it to my favorites. :) I think this is one of the first macro shots of neon tubing I've ever seen. Not only is it incredibly original, but it is PERFECTLY done. The amount of exposure is dead-on. And the composition is perfect to boot!

I only have one VERY small criticism - and that's that the red portion of the border is varying in widths. That occurs when you increase the canvas size by an odd number. I've run into that before, and get around it by always increasing in increments of even numbers. For example, I usually just resize the image to 628, extend canvas height and width (in foreground color) by 4 pixels, then extend canvas by 8 pixels (in black). That always ensures that border lines are the same width. I know, I know - very nit-picky. Just thought I'd throw in my $.02 though. ;) Yet again, AWESOME shot! :D
